Lone Star Disposal LP, Houston, has announced the opening of the Lone Star Recycling & Disposal Facility, a Type IV construction and demolition (C&D) landfill located in
The 192-acre site is permitted for 14.7 million cubic yards of material and has an estimated life of more than 30 years.
“This facility is strategically located in a prime growth corridor within close proximity to downtown. It will complement our existing roll-off and C&D recycling operations and provide us vertical integration. The landfill, along with the addition of another recycling facility opening in 2009, will allow increased operating efficiencies and enable us to better serve our customers and continued growth,” says Brett Sarver, president.
